ODOT: $40 million in taxes could be better spent
With spring in full force, the snow has cleared around Ohio, revealing many roadways lined with litter.Aside from being an eyesore, it’s also an expense to taxpayers.Litter pickup costs the Ohio Department of Transportation (ODOT) about $4 million each year, including the cost for guards who monitor inmates and supplies for inmates, as well as Adopt-A-Highway volunteers.“Our crews would rather be doing more useful work and we would certainly rather spend this money on more useful thi
